About Qinghong Shen

Qinghong Shen is a scholar working on Signal Processing, Media Technology and Complementary and alternative medicine, having authored 19 papers that have together received 319 indexed citations. Recurring topics across this work include Structural Health Monitoring Techniques (3 papers), Digital Filter Design and Implementation (3 papers) and Numerical Methods and Algorithms (3 papers). The work is most often cited by research in Signal Processing (68 citations), Statistical and Nonlinear Physics (74 citations) and Economics and Econometrics (89 citations). Qinghong Shen has collaborated with scholars based in China, United States and Sweden. Frequent co-authors include Chunhua Bian, D. Y. Qianli, Qin Chang, Hongbing Pan, Zhongfeng Wang, Yang Gao, Yajun Ha, Yinghuan Shi, Zhonghai Lu and Haibo Zhou. Their work appears in journals such as IEEE Internet of Things Journal, Frontiers in Pharmacology and Applied Sciences.
